Abstract

This utility model provides a corner reinforcement structure for interior walls made of aut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) panels. The AAC panels are L-shaped, with inner and outer locking slots on their tops. Two corner locking components (II) are provided on the surfaces of the two inner locking slots, and one corner locking component (I) is provided on the surfaces of the two outer locking slots. Both corner locking components (I and II) are L-shaped. A locking screw is installed on one side of corner locking component I, and a nut is threaded onto the locking screw. This utility model, through the combined use of corner locking components I and II, effectively enhances the stability of interior wall corners. The connection method of the locking screw and nut makes installation and disassembly more convenient while ensuring the structural integrity.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) panel reinforcement, specifically a corner reinforcement structure for the interior wall of an AAC panel. Background Technology

[0002] AAC panels, used for both interior and exterior walls, offer faster construction, are more environmentally friendly, have shorter construction cycles, and superior performance in terms of insulation, soundproofing, and fire resistance.

[0003] During the construction of building projects, the installation of aut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) panel walls often involves corner areas. If a proper formwork support system is lacking to effectively secure these corner areas, the construction quality will be difficult to guarantee. Insufficient connection between the concrete panels at corners severely affects their load-bearing capacity and seismic performance. Unstable corner connections can easily lead to safety hazards during subsequent use.

[0004] In summary, this utility model provides a corner reinforcement structure for aut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) panels to solve the above-mentioned problems. Utility Model Content

[0005] To address the aforementioned technical problems, this utility model provides a corner reinforcement structure for aut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) panels, which solves the problem that the existing weak corner connection methods are prone to safety hazards during subsequent use.

[0006] A corner reinforcement structure for an autoclaved aerated concrete (AAC) panel interior wall includes an AAC panel in an "L" shape. The top of the AAC panel has an inner clamping groove and an outer clamping groove. Two corner clamps are provided on the surfaces of the two inner clamping grooves, and two corner clamps are provided on the surfaces of the two outer clamping grooves. Both corner clamps are "L" shaped. A locking screw is installed on one side of corner clamp one, and a nut is threaded onto the locking screw. The AAC panel has protrusion grooves, and a reinforcing protrusion is installed on the inner right-angled surface of corner clamp one.

[0007] Furthermore, the inner right-angled surface of the corner clip one is attached to the surface of the outer clip groove, the reinforcing protrusion is provided along the two sides of the inner right angle of the corner clip one, and the locking screw is installed on the side surface of the corner clip one near the reinforcing protrusion.

[0008] Furthermore, the outer right-angled surface of the second corner clip fits into the surface of the inner clip groove, and the second corner clip has through holes, which are correspondingly set with locking screws.

[0009] Furthermore, one end of the locking screw passes through the aerated concrete slab and the through hole, and the nut is located on one side of the corner clip.

[0010] Furthermore, the reinforcing protrusions and the inner grooves of the protrusions are arranged in a one-to-one correspondence, and the sizes of the reinforcing protrusions and the inner grooves of the protrusions are matched.

[0011] Furthermore, the inner groove of the protrusion is formed on the side of the aerated concrete plate near the outer clamping slot and is connected to the outer clamping slot.

[0029] Specific working principle:

[0030] It mainly includes an L-shaped aerated concrete panel 1, with the corners between them reinforced. At the top edge of the aerated concrete panel 1, two key connection parts, an inner clamping groove 7 and an outer clamping groove 8, are precisely opened respectively.

[0031] Among them, the surfaces of the two inner clamping slots 7 are fixedly installed with corner clamps 2 3 by mechanical connection, while the surfaces of the two outer clamping slots 8 are respectively installed with corner clamps 1 2. The corner clamps are all made of high-strength metal material and have an L-shaped structure to ensure the stability of the connection.

[0032] An adjustable locking screw 6 is designed on one side of the corner clamp 2, with a matching nut 4 on the screw, allowing for precise control of the tightening force through rotation. The two corner clamps are fixed to both sides of the aerated concrete panel 1, and this double-reinforcement design significantly improves the shear strength and overall stability of the corner. The entire reinforcement structure is rationally designed, easy to install, and effectively solves the problem of cracking at traditional interior wall corners.

[0033] The inner groove 9 of the protrusion is designed to be located in a specific area of ​​the aerated concrete panel 1, specifically near the edge of the outer retaining groove 8. The inner groove 9 and the outer retaining groove 8 are structurally interconnected, seamlessly connected through the opening in the inner groove 9. This design allows the inner groove 9 and the outer retaining groove 8 to cooperate effectively, thus enhancing the overall functionality of the aerated concrete panel 1. By placing the inner groove 9 adjacent to the outer retaining groove 8, the connection between components is strengthened, improving the stability and reliability of the overall structure.
